Output ebe24c524b36eccd3a9abc21bbf49bfadf8a47301ea2ab4fdf3be0687c0db40e:0

value
139728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d632407f7e2716e4215294752972f535fe9ded50 OP_EQUAL
address
3MDajALgdpSEZxjEsWwF4mCAbRJ89pXpAv
transaction
ebe24c524b36eccd3a9abc21bbf49bfadf8a47301ea2ab4fdf3be0687c0db40e
confirmations
319292
spent
true